Гаврилов Алексей

12
Рейтинг

Skromnyi
Алексей Гаврилов



  •   Регистрация: 17.07.2008 (15 лет назад)

  •   Был(а) на сайте: 26.04.2024

Друзья
  • Сергей Капустин
  • АЛЕКСЕЙ КОЗЫРЕВ
  • Дмитрий Малышев
  • Евгений Комиссаров
  • Андрей Волин
Подписчики 12

Группы

IE 2015 Участник

IE 2016 Участник

IE 2018 Участник

IE2022 Участник

IE2023 Online

Рейтинг 12

Печать почтовых конвертов из 1С:Документооборот

Отчеты и формы Для всех Платформа 1С v8.3 1С:Документооборот Россия Windows Абонемент ($m) Внешняя обработка (ert,epf) Печатные формы

Внешняя обработка для печати почтовых конвертов различных форматов (Envelope DL, Envelope C5, Envelope C4, Envelope C6) из 1С:Документооборот.

1 стартмани

01.11.2013    16300    136    Skromnyi    34       

12

Комментарии

AdminНе работает серверная отладка#2 25.10.23 15:42
а если так запустить: Сервис - Параметры - Запуск 1С:Предприятия: Параметр запуска: РежимОтладки

Прикрепленные файлы:

Параметры запуска.jpg
DevПроверка заполнения по условию#4 12.10.23 16:51
(2) и потом да, отключаем проверку в "ОбработкаПроверкиЗаполнения".
DevПроверка заполнения по условию#2 12.10.23 16:37
Через условное оформление.
AdminОтключение проверки на уникальность регистрационного номера документа#15 05.10.23 11:03
(14) не правильно, я написал где надо вносить правки и привел пример.
Devне работает описаниеОповещения#2 05.10.23 10:02
А почему через "ПолучитьФорму", а не через "ОткрытьФорму"?
AdminОтключение проверки на уникальность регистрационного номера документа#13 05.10.23 9:55
(12) Что значит Возврат = Истина ?????
У Вас должно быть что-то типа такого:
Код
Функция РегистрационныйНомерУникален(Объект) Экспорт
   
   УстановитьПривилегированныйРежим(Истина);
   
   Нумератор = Нумерация.ПолучитьНумераторДокумента(Объект);
   Если Не ЗначениеЗаполнено(Нумератор) Тогда // документ без номера
      Если НРег(Объект.РегистрационныйНомер) = НСтр("ru = 'б\н'") 
       Или НРег(Объект.РегистрационныйНомер) = НСтр("ru = 'б/н'") Тогда 
         Возврат Истина;
      КонецЕсли;
   КонецЕсли;
   
   //  Начало изменений
   Если ЗначениеЗаполнено(Нумератор)
      И Нумератор.Наименование = "Какое-то наименование Вашего нумератора" Тогда
      Возврат Истина;
   КонецЕсли;
   // Конец изменений
   
   Если ЗначениеЗаполнено(Нумератор) Тогда // автонумерация
AdminОтключение проверки на уникальность регистрационного номера документа#11 05.10.23 9:00
(9) ну, все правильно, в этой функции "РегистрационныйНомерУникален" общего модуля "Делопроизводство" Вам надо проверить, что за документ регистрируется, и если это Ваш вид документа верните "Истина".
AdminОтключение проверки на уникальность регистрационного номера документа#8 05.10.23 8:54
(5) ну вот в этой функции, что я писал выше и проверяете.
AdminОтключение проверки на уникальность регистрационного номера документа#2 05.10.23 8:44
Это для всех видов документов или для какого-то одного?
Смотрите общий модуль "Делопроизводство", функция "РегистрационныйНомерУникален".
DevВывод печатной формы с внешней обработки#2 04.10.23 16:26
На вскидку ошибка в этой строке:
Код
ДобавитьКоманду(ТаблицаКоманд, "Договор-Поставки (Внешняя)", "ДоговорПоПоставкам", "ОткрытиеФормы", Истина, "ПечатьMXL");

Не "ОткрытиеФормы" должно быть, а "ВызовСерверногоМетода"